  1. I am at wits end trying to find a program that can capture a vcd mpeg image for use as the cd cover image. What do ppl use? I am running XP if that helps. Most programs I try that do screen grabs give me black images where the mpeg image is on real or WM.

  3. There are many ways.

    1. Load up the MPEG with a proggy like PowerDVD and play to the part you want to capture. Prese "C" to capture to clipboard. Paste in your favourite image editing program.

    2. Load up your MPEG with VirtualDub. Go to the frame you want to capture. Then, in the toolbar, click on "Copy Source Frame". In the newer versions of VirtualDub, you can press "Ctrl+1" to do this as a keyboard shortcut. Paste in your favourite image editing program.

    3. Load up your MPEG with Windows Media Player. In the options, set hardware acceleration to none. Then, when you get to the part you want to capture, press "Print Screen". Paste in your favourite image editing program.
